ILS Atari Keyboard Replacement Hardware Project!


Recommended Posts

ILS http://www.realdos.net has created a hardware board that works in parallel with the Atari Keyboard. I have both the DataQue TransKey and AKI keyboard interface that are no longer made and we still have need of them. Most all my Atari 130xe Keyboards have dead keys so we decided to build some for our own use. We got several e-mails about others wanting to get a Keyboard interface of some kind. The ILS KRH (Keyboard Replacement Hardware) functions like an AKI except we had to use a different PIC Processor.
